Hybrid batteries themselves rarely make noise. However, sounds may come from cooling fans or battery systems managing temperature and performance. If unusual noises occur, consult a professional to ensure there are no underlying issues with your vehicle.

  1. Why do hybrid vehicles sometimes make noise from the battery area? Noise from a hybrid vehicle’s battery area usually comes from cooling fans or battery management systems working to regulate temperature and ensure optimal performance.
  2. Should I be concerned if my hybrid battery makes unusual noises? Yes, unusual or persistent noises could indicate a problem with your hybrid battery system, so it is advisable to have a professional inspection to prevent further issues.
  3. Do hybrid batteries themselves generate any sound during operation? No, hybrid batteries themselves rarely produce noise. Most sounds relate to ancillary components like cooling fans or electronic controls.
